TP钱包持续显示“打包中”并非单一故障,而是链上与链下多因素叠加的结果。常见病因包括:一是链上拥堵或手续费(Gas/费率)过低导致矿工/出块者未优先打包;二是交易nonce不连续或存在未确认父交易;三是钱包客户端或后端节点不同步、RPC请求丢失;四是跨链/侧链桥接延迟或中继未完成交易最终性。技术路径上,交易在本地签名后需经TLS加密通道可靠广播到节点(参见RFC8446/TLS1.3),随后经历签名校验、Merkle路径与状态转换验证,再进入mempool等待共识层打包[1][2]。
为提升排查效率,建议构建高效能智能平台:接入多节点并行播发、实时汇聚全球mempool与费用曲线,通过机器学习预测短期费率并自动触发“re-send/replace-by-fee”策略;对跨链与侧链(如Liquid/Plasma/Polkadot设计思想)引入专门监控器,跟踪桥接Tx的确认进度与中继状态[3][4]。从交易验证角度,应验证签名、nonce、gas限制与父交易状态,必要时使用raw-tx在不同节点重广播或提交更高费用的替代交易(EIP-1559风格替换)。
专家观点认为:优化用户体验需兼顾安全与效率——采用端到端TLS与节点身份校验可以降低网络层失败率,侧链或Layer2能显著缓解主链拥堵但需关注最终性与可裁决性。全球化数据分析能提供更准确的费率模型与拥堵预警,提高成功打包概率[5]。实施建议:先确认nonce与父交易,再检查费率并考虑重发;若频繁发生,部署多节点RPC、开启交易回溯日志并接入第三方全局mempool数据源。
参考文献:RFC8446 (TLS1.3)[1];Ethereum Yellow Paper(G. Wood, 2014)[2];Poon & Buterin, Plasma(2017)与Blockstream/Elements(Liquid)相关技术报告[3][4]。
您希望采取以下哪种优先策略?
1) 立即增加费用并重发交易; 2) 检查nonce与未确认父交易; 3) 切换多节点/更换RPC服务; 4) 启用侧链/Layer2通道。
FAQ:
Q1: 如果钱包界面一直“打包中”,多久应考虑重发?

A1: 若超过当前链平均确认时长的3倍且nonce无阻塞,可考虑替换交易(更高费率)或广播raw-tx。

Q2: TLS对交易打包有何影响?
A2: TLS保障RPC与节点通信的完整性与机密性,能避免中间重放或丢包导致的广播失败,但不能改变链上拥堵本身。
Q3: 侧链能完全解决打包慢的问题吗?
A3: 侧链/Layer2能显著提升吞吐与成本,但需在桥接最终性与安全模型上做权衡,不能完全替代主链确认要求。
评论
Alice88
很实用的排查清单,我先去看nonce。
链观测者
建议补充各公链当前的费率标准和mempool阈值数据源链接。
TomCrypto
侧链监控确实重要,尤其是跨链桥接失败时排查更麻烦。
数据分析师李
高性能智能平台部分可以考虑接入实时费率预测API提升体验。